Air duct cleaning is a crucial service focused on removing accumulated dust, debris, allergens, and other contaminants from your home's he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) system. Over months and years, these ducts can become reservoirs for anything from dust mites and pet dander to mold spores and construction debris, directly impacting the air you and your family breathe. For families in Wyckoff, ensuring clean ducts means a noticeable improvement in indoor air quality, reducing potential triggers for allergies and respiratory issues, and contributing to a fresher, more comfortable living space within your cherished home.
The process of professional air duct cleaning involves specialized equipment designed to dislodge and remove stubborn contaminants from inside your ductwork. Our technicians employ high-powered vacuums with HEPA filtration, along with rotary brushes and air whips, to effectively agitate and pull debris from all surfaces. This meticulous approach ensures that both supply and return air ducts, as well as critical components like the furnace blower and evaporator coils, are thoroughly addressed, leaving your system significantly cleaner.

While often overlooked, maintaining clean air ducts is vital for the overall health and efficiency of your entire HVAC system and, by extension, your home environment. Accumulated dust and debris can impede airflow, forcing your furnace or air conditioner to work harder, which can lead to increased energy consumption and premature system wear. More critically, dirty ducts can harbor mold and bacteria, which then circulate allergens and irritants throughout your living spaces, posing potential health risks. Regular cleaning contributes significantly to a safer, more hygienic indoor atmosphere, helping to prevent the recirculation of airborne contaminants and ensuring your system operates at peak performance.
It is important to understand that air duct cleaning is a distinct service from other home maintenance tasks, such as furnace tune-ups or dryer vent cleaning. While your furnace may be cleaned as part of comprehensive HVAC maintenance, air duct cleaning specifically targets the extensive network of ventilation channels that distribute conditioned air throughout your home. Dryer vent cleaning, on the other hand, focuses on removing highly flammable lint from the clothes dryer exhaust system, a critical fire safety measure. Each service plays a unique and essential role in maintaining a healthy, efficient, and safe home in Wyckoff, with air duct cleaning directly addressing your indoor air quality.
Knowing when to schedule an air duct cleaning is key to proactive home maintenance, especially for Wyckoff residents. Most experts recommend a professional cleaning every three to five years, but certain factors might necessitate earlier intervention. If you’ve recently completed home renovations, moved into an older home, have pets, or notice an increase in allergy symptoms among family members, a cleaning could be beneficial. Scheduling this service after the spring pollen season, or before the winter heating season, can maximize its impact on your home's air quality.

How it works
Our certified technicians will first inspect your Wyckoff home's entire HVAC system and ductwork to assess its condition and identify any specific issues. We then seal off vents and create access points, connecting our powerful, truck-mounted vacuum system to the main trunk line, ensuring proper negative pressure is established to contain debris.
Using specialized rotary brushes, air whips, and compressed air nozzles, we meticulously dislodge and agitate accumulated dust, pollen, and debris from the interior surfaces of all supply and return ducts. This loosened material is then safely extracted and pulled directly into our HEPA-filtered vacuum unit, preventing its recirculation into your home.
Once all ductwork is thoroughly cleaned, we close all access points and conduct a final system check to ensure proper operation and air flow. Upon request, we can apply an EPA-approved sanitizing agent to the ducts, further enhancing your Wyckoff home's indoor air quality and leaving a fresh, clean scent.
